Overview

Embarking on a career in the machining trade in Albany, NY, often begins with specialized apprenticeships that blend hands-on experience with classroom instruction, allowing individuals to earn while they learn. These apprenticeships typically span four to five years and involve extensive training under seasoned professionals.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the national employment for machinists stands at approximately 288,789, with a median annual wage of $50,840. In Albany, NY, the average weekly wage for machinists is around $496, with experienced professionals often earning over $100,000 annually. Educational pathways such as apprenticeships and postsecondary programs, supported by institutions like the National Institute for Metalworking Skills, provide aspiring machinists with the necessary skills and credentials, leading to a rewarding career with strong earning potential.
